Output 244096a002a3975cf773c946331e779edef7a769ea8fd04762de4ae755c7a934:8

value
673963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1619dc108a0135a6fb50fafb1155ec8144077221 OP_EQUAL
address
33hsmXFiMrjL6VhrM2c77yJRxM9szEW9zj
transaction
244096a002a3975cf773c946331e779edef7a769ea8fd04762de4ae755c7a934
spent
true